What Are Thermoformed Agricultural Products?
Thermoforming is a manufacturing process in which plastic sheets are heated until pliable, then formed over a mold and trimmed into their final shape. In agriculture, this process is used to create lightweight yet rigid packaging solutions designed specifically for produce handling.
Common thermoformed agricultural products include:
- Fruit baskets
- Produce trays
- Berry clamshells
- Protective inserts
- Seedling and planting trays
These products are typically made from food-grade plastics such as PET, rPET, or polypropylene, ensuring safety while offering excellent strength-to-weight ratios.
Supporting the Harvesting Process
The journey of fresh produce begins in the field, where handling is one of the most critical moments for preventing damage. Thermoformed fruit baskets and trays are designed to support efficient harvesting operations.
Their lightweight construction allows workers to carry larger quantities without strain, while rigid walls help prevent crushing and bruising. Smooth contours and carefully engineered shapes minimize pressure points that could damage delicate fruits like peaches, berries, or tomatoes.
By reducing handling damage at the earliest stage, thermoformed products help growers maintain higher-quality yields and reduce loss before produce ever leaves the farm.
Protection During Storage and Transportation
Once harvested, produce must be stored and transported—often across long distances. This stage presents some of the greatest risks to product integrity, making protective packaging essential.
Thermoformed agricultural packaging provides:
- Structural stability that supports stacking
- Uniform sizing for efficient palletization
- Secure containment that prevents shifting during transit
Fruit baskets and trays are engineered to interlock or stack evenly, maximizing space in trucks and cold storage facilities. This not only protects the produce but also reduces transportation costs by optimizing load efficiency.
Ventilation and Freshness Preservation
Fresh produce is highly sensitive to moisture and temperature changes. Thermoformed agricultural products are commonly designed with strategically placed vent holes, allowing air to circulate freely around fruits and vegetables.
This ventilation:
- Reduces condensation buildup
- Helps regulate temperature
- Slows mold and spoilage
- Supports cold-chain logistics
For items like berries, grapes, and leafy greens, airflow is essential to maintaining shelf life. Thermoformed packaging balances protection with breathability, ensuring produce arrives at its destination in optimal condition.
Enhancing Food Safety and Hygiene
Food safety is a top priority in agriculture and retail environments. Thermoformed packaging helps minimize contamination risks by creating a clean, controlled barrier between produce and external handling.
Benefits include:
- Reduced direct contact with consumers
- Protection from dust, debris, and pathogens
- Compliance with food-contact safety standards
Single-use or recyclable thermoformed packaging limits cross-contamination while still allowing visibility and inspection. This is particularly important in high-traffic retail environments where produce is frequently handled.

Specialized Applications Across Agriculture
Thermoformed products are not limited to fresh fruit packaging. Their adaptability makes them suitable for a wide range of agricultural applications, including:
- Berry clamshells for strawberries, blueberries, and raspberries
- Egg cartons designed for protection and stacking
- Produce inserts for delicate or high-value fruits
- Seedling trays used in nurseries and greenhouses
Each product can be custom-designed to meet the specific needs of a crop, ensuring proper support, spacing, and airflow.
Sustainability and the Future of Agricultural Packaging
As sustainability becomes increasingly important, thermoformed packaging continues to evolve. Manufacturers are responding with eco-conscious innovations that reduce environmental impact while maintaining performance.
Key sustainability trends include:
- Use of recycled PET (rPET)
- Lightweight designs that reduce material usage
- Packaging compatible with existing recycling streams
- Exploration of biodegradable and compostable materials
By balancing durability with responsible material choices, thermoformed agricultural products help reduce waste throughout the supply chain while supporting sustainability goals.
